Abstract:

A novel oxalate compound {(H(2)en)(H3O)[BiPb(C2O4)(4)(H2O)(2)]center dot 2(H2O)}(n) 1 (en = ethylenediamine) containing lead and bismuth has been synthesized by hydrothermal methods, and structurally characterized by X-ray single-crystal diffraction. It crystallizes in monoclinic, space group P2(1)/c with a = 11.6160(1), b = 12.7426(1), c = 15.5683(5) angstrom, beta = 108.442(4)degrees, BiPbC10N2O21H21, M-r = 921.46, V = 2186.0(4) angstrom(3), Z = 4, D-c = 2.800 g/cm(3), F(000) = 1712 and mu(MoK alpha) = 15.837 mm(-1). The final R = 0.0502 and wR = 0.1261 for 3391 observed reflections with I > 2 sigma(I). The title compound consists of 2-D polyanions and protonized organic amine cations, and they are combined to each other by static attractive force and H-bonds to form the so-called organic-inorganic hybrid material.
